  • Creating meaningful and engaging quests

    - by user384918
    Kill X number of monsters. Gather Y number of items (usually by killing X number of monsters). Deliver this NPC's package to this other NPC who is far far away. etc. Yeah. These quests are easy to implement, easy to complete, but also very boring after the first few times. It's kind of disingenuous to call them quests really; they're more like chores or errands. What ideas for quests have people seen that were well designed, immersive, and rewarding? What specific things did the developers do that made it so? What are some ideas you would use (or have used) to make quests more interesting?

  • jQuery .Flv Player

    - by H(at)Ni
    I've recently used a cool .Flv player to play video files that are uploaded by site admin and thought it's good to share. Download from: http://flowplayer.org/ Using this control is very simple, just follow those steps : 1. Create an anchor with href equals to the video url  <a href="Video.flv" id="MyPlayer" ></a>   2. Add path to the player's javascript file <script type="text/javascript" src="flowplayer-3.2.4.min.js"></script> 3. Simple call to a function named flowplayer with the anchor id, and path of the player's swf file     <script type="text/javascript">       $(document).ready(function () {       flowplayer("MyPlayer", "flowplayer-3.2.5.swf");       });     </script>
